| Designed in the 19th century by Henry Hobson Richardson and Frederick Law Olmsted, Robert Treat Paine Estate is the ideal country home of housing reformer Robert Treat Paine and his family. Visitors may stroll the grounds or hike the woodland trails that wind through 109 acres of conservation land surrounding the estate. This innovative home retains its original Victorian furnishings, paintings, and decorative arts as well as Paine family archives. |
